Artificial intelligence has ventured into content creation with its own TV channel now available on the Roku Channel streaming platform.
Fairground AI Creator TV, offering round-the-clock AI-generated content for free, quietly joined Roku’s lineup without an official announcement from the streaming service. The news was first reported by Cord Cutters News.
However, the introduction of this innovative channel has sparked backlash online, with critics expressing discontent over Roku’s decision. Frank Landymore of Futurism described the channel as “an unending conveyor belt of AI slop,” while Bradly Shankar of MobileSyrup echoed similar sentiments.
Fairground AI operates as a FAST channel, providing free, ad-supported streaming television. Although there are approximately 200 FAST channels on the Roku Channel in Canada, Fairground AI is currently not among them. The company has not disclosed any plans regarding the channel’s availability in Canada.
